While these skills provide a strong foundation, the world of QA is vast and ever-evolving. Remember, every tester brings a unique perspective, so it’s worth comparing in-house and outsourced testing and choosing the best approach for you. White box testing is often performed by developers or testers with programming expertise who can analyze the codebase and identify potential weaknesses or vulnerabilities. It complements black box testing by providing insights into the system’s internal behavior and uncovering issues that may not be apparent from external testing alone. The goal is to verify that the software functions correctly according to its specifications and meets user requirements.
UI Testing
In this article, we have discussed detailed information about manual testing as well as automated testing. You will also find the key difference between manual and automated software testing along with the popular tool that is used for manual testing. In Gray Box Testing this technique is the combination of both white-box testing and black-box testing. Here, the internal structure of the application is partially known by the tester. The tester will check both the internal structure and the functionality of the application manually.
What is QA Process?
Manual testing does not require advanced scripting knowledge and is relatively easy to perform. However, it can be time-consuming for large projects and is prone to human errors. Manual testing involves human testers executing test cases without tools, while automated testing uses scripts and software to perform tests. Manual testing is ideal for usability, exploratory, and ad-hoc testing, while automation is suited for repetitive and regression tests.
Top 7 QA and Software Testing Trends in 2022
Each test case should include preconditions, steps to execute, expected results, and postconditions. However, when it comes to planning an effective QA strategy, the usual dilemma companies face is whether they should perform manual testing or replace it with test automation. In White Box Testing technique, QA Manual job the person will check the internal structure of the system like designs, coding, etc., manually.
Choose QualityHive to Improve Manual QA Productivity
The first step is to understand the client’s requirements for the project. Specifically, what needs to be tested and what the expected outcomes are. Start by getting familiar with the software’s functional and non-functional requirements, as well as any design documents or user stories.
Have you ever had to create a test plan from scratch? If so, what steps did you take?
Vanessa started her career in the pharmaceutical industry working for Celltech (now Lonza) in 1989 primarily working in their manufacturing sites, as a cell culture and fermentation technician. After moving to Evans Medical Limited (now Novartis Vaccines), Vanessa worked in Quality Assurance and then specialised in Documentation. Vanessa then worked for Oxoid (now Thermo Fisher Scientific Oxoid Ltd) for 3 years also in Quality Assurance where she trained as an internal auditor. Following this, Vanessa became a Customer Operations Consultant for GlaxoSmithKline providing first line support during and after their SAP implementation specialising in production and manufacturing areas. She has extensive experience of working in both ethical and generic pharmaceutical companies and with a wide range of dosage forms. She is eligible to work both as a Qualified Person (QP) and a Responsible Person (RP), having extensive GMP and GDP experience internationally.
- This approach ensures thoroughness and efficiency throughout the testing process.
- More recently, Matt worked as GMP Learning and Development Manager for Lonza Biologics and draws on all his varied experience to create a lively, relevant training environment.
- But this doesn’t have to be an issue for you, and your organisation can be known for its streamlined QA process with the right resources in place.
- The QA team also enables the Quality Control (QC) team to detect and resolve technical issues.
- On the flip side, manual testing is time-consuming if testers are working on a big project, and you can never exclude the possibility of human error.
- Manual testing can be relatively straightforward for beginners, as it doesn’t require specialized technical skills or knowledge of programming languages.
Speak to one of our testing experts
Whether your business is looking to satisfy ISO 9001 requirements better or needs a way to ease the transition to a new quality management system, a quality manual can help. Although creating the documentation seems complicated at first, it is quite straightforward with the right template. A well-written quality manual acts as an interface between the generic standard and the requirements deployed by your business’s management system. It conveys how the quality management system works and what controls are in place to manage each process. Therefore, your organization’s size, context, complexity and the extent of its individual processes will heavily influence the content volume in the quality manual. Some prioritize domain knowledge and years of experience, while others look for a devoted newbie that can provide a fresh perspective.
Types of manual testing
The QA team meets with stakeholders (product managers, project managers, etc.) to collaborate and understand exactly what the end goal is. Exploratory testing is a flexible, ad hoc technique of manual testing where the testers, upon their findings, dynamically alter their strategies and test cases with every progress in testing. Emma’s particular interests are quality management systems and the individual elements within them, including problem solving, change management, management review, training and continuous improvement. Neil is an experienced Quality leader full-stack developer and Qualified Person with over 35 years of pharmaceutical industry experience. He has been a registered QP on several site MIAs and MIA (IMP)s for multiple dosage forms for human pharmaceutical medicinal products, including sterile products, solid dose and ATMPs.
- The goal is to verify that the software functions correctly according to its specifications and meets user requirements.
- They provide a clean and responsive user interface (UI), deliver a great user experience (UX), and keep users safe from cyber threats.
- Additionally, I pay close attention to visual elements like layout, fonts, and images to ensure consistency in user experience.
- If it returns the expected output, then the tester will proceed with another set of inputs and report all the results to the team.
- It also makes sure that reported defects are fixed by developers and re-testing has been performed by testers on the fixed defects.
His passion for innovation and technology made him drive Sphinx Solutions with ease. He holds excellent management with a futuristic view for developing apps in the field of AI, Blockchain, Mobile, Web and Software. Install the software on multiple mobile platforms, including Android and iOS. Ensure you have a stable internet connection and that your test accounts are set up to place orders. Testers share feedback with developers, project managers, and other stakeholders. If any ideas or improvements for future testing cycles arise, they are also noted.